Formation of supermassive black holes by direct collapse in pre-galactic haloes
TL;DR: In this paper, the authors describe a mechanism by which supermassive black holes (SMBHs) can form directly in the nuclei of protogalaxies, without the need for'seed' black holes left over from early star formation.

Formation of supermassive black holes
TL;DR: In this article, the authors review some of the physical processes that are conducive to the evolution of the massive black hole population and discuss black hole formation processes for'seed' black holes that are likely to place at early cosmic epochs.
